Hi 9mohit2 Win32::OLE->LastError() will give you the last recorded OLE error and able to trace why the issue has occured. Please look into below link http://docs.activestate.com/activeperl/5.8/lib/Win32/OLE.html for more details. Also if the perl script is expecting any input from user during execution it may not go well.
